PM: Govt won't interfere if any university decides to ban student politics

Every university has its own committee and they will take the decision, she said

Update : 09 Oct 2019, 05:03 PM

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ina has said the government will not interfere if any university decides to ban student politics. 

“Every university has its own committee and they will take the decision,” the premier said while addressing a press conference on her recent US and India tour at Ganabhaban in Dhaka on Wednesday.

Buet students have placed an 8-point demand, including banning student politics, before the university authorities following the murder of Abrar Fahad inside Sher-E-Bangla residential hall on Monday.

Some Chhatra League leaders have been accused of beating him to death for his alleged involvement with Islami Chhatra Shibir, the student wing of Jamaat-e-Islami.

Later, Bangladesh Chhatra League expelled 11 of its members permanently from the organization for their involvement in the murder.

The demonstrators also threaten to cancel Buet honours admission examinations through massive protests if their demands are not met.
